Ironman 70.3 Augusta

Website

IRONMAN 70.3 Augusta is a scenic and challenging triathlon held in Augusta, Georgia, known for its blend of sports, culture, and Southern hospitality. The race features a 1.2-mile downriver swim in the Savannah River, followed by a 56-mile bike ride through rural Augusta’s picturesque backcountry. The event concludes with a flat, 13.1-mile run along the shaded North Augusta Greeneway trail, offering a spectator-friendly atmosphere.

This course is suitable for athletes of all levels, from first-timers to seasoned competitors seeking personal bests. The race also celebrates Augusta’s rich heritage, including ties to legendary musician James Brown and the famous Masters golf tournament.
